Active Listening. Effective leaders know when they need to talk and, more importantly, when they need to listen. Show that you care by asking for employees’ opinions, ideas, and feedback. And when they do share, actively engage in the conversation—pose questions, invite them to elaborate, and take notes.

Related: Communication Goal Examples for Effective Business … WebJan 10, 2024 · Adapting your communication style also provides practice at becoming behaviorally agile. The ability to switch modes between listening, input gathering, coaching, directing, and advising is a skill that is developed over time. Practicing communication agility will start to build the mental muscles needed for becoming nimble in other contexts. 4.
